Singapore education startup seeks to digitize schools in Southeast Asia

Philippines, Vietnam to be targeted by Manabie following Japan market success

TOKYO -- Singapore-based and Japanese-run education startup Manabie International is embarking on a mission to roll out services that will digitize schools in the Philippines and Vietnam later this year, betting that digitization to be integral to meeting the rising education goals in rapidly growing Southeast Asia.
